As part of our vacation in the Cape Coast region, we went to see some famous slave castles. The Elmina Slave Castle and the Cape Coast Slave Castle. The Elmina castle was owned and used by the Dutch and Portuguese (but obviously not at the same time). The Cape Coast castle was owned and used by the British. We took the tour at the Elmina castle, the more famous of the two, and walked through the Cape Coast castle. It's really difficult to comprehend what the slaves had to go through. After seeing the dungeons and the amount of space they were allowed to have and hearing about what they did to the slaves, it's really unbelievable that people could be so cruel.
